A prominent data analytics company in Manchester is seeking an AI Placement Analyst for a student placement program. The role involves collecting and processing large datasets, applying machine learning algorithms, and collaborating with teams to derive data-driven insights.
Students pursuing relevant degrees with strong Python skills and a background in data analysis are encouraged to apply. This paid internship offers exposure to real-world projects in a hybrid work environ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at PRGX Global Inc.
✨Know Your Python Inside Out
Make sure you brush up on your Python skills before the interview. Be ready to discuss specific libraries you've used, like Pandas or NumPy, and how you've applied them in data analysis projects. This will show that you're not just familiar with the language but can also use it effectively in real-world scenarios.
✨Showcase Your Data Analysis Experience
Prepare to talk about any relevant projects where you've collected and processed large datasets. Highlight the methods you used, the challenges you faced, and the insights you derived. This will demonstrate your hands-on experience and ability to contribute to the team right away.
✨Understand Machine Learning Basics
Since the role involves applying machine learning algorithms, make sure you have a solid grasp of the basics. Be ready to explain different algorithms, their applications, and perhaps even a project where you implemented one. This will show your enthusiasm for the field and your readiness to learn more.
✨Be Ready to Collaborate
Collaboration is key in this role, so think of examples where you've worked in a team setting. Prepare to discuss how you communicate ideas and handle feedback. This will highlight your interpersonal skills and show that you can thrive in a hybrid work environment.
